A book told in chapters that alternate between stories about 15 students and their own contributions to the book. They are a new 7th grade class at Rio Grande Middle School in Albuquerque. They were drawn from schools all over the city and asked to raise money for the school. They decide to write and sell a book. This is it and it is filled with stories, traditions and recipes. Carolyn Meyer is the author of "Where the Broken Heart Still Beats" and "White Lilacs." 257p. SCW01833
